A good travel app lets you save locations directly from posts. Say you spot a stunning beach on Instagram; the app can store that spot with just a tap, along with reviews and tips from other travelers. This kind of detail makes planning realistic. You don’t have to guess which places are worth your time because you have firsthand feedback at your fingertips. It’s like having a mini travel guide built from authentic experiences.

Keeping your saved spots organized is more than just neatness. Effective apps let you create categories or tabs, for cities, activities like dining or sightseeing, or even types of adventures like hiking or cultural tours. That way, when you’re packing or making daily plans, you pull up exactly what fits your mood or schedule. It saves time and avoids the frustration of digging through a jumble of locations.

Adding notes to each saved place helps keep the original inspiration alive. Maybe a photo caught your eye because of the unique street art or the promise of a spectacular sunset view. Recording those reasons means when you review your list later, it feels personal, not just a random collection. It also prevents confusion during trip prep, so you don’t book something that no longer excites you.
